2012-13 - Sophomore
- In the regular season finale, led the V4+ to a fourth place finish against Princeton, Dartmouth and Penn with a time of 7:56.8
- Finished in sixth place with the varsity four in the Clemson Invitational with a time of 7:52.6 in the first session, followed by a 7:34.3 fourth place finish in the second. In the second day, placed fifth in the V4 with time of 8:27.6.
- At the Ohio State Invitational, coxed the varsity eight to two second place finishes with a time of 7:23.7 in the first session and 7:33.85 in the second session.
- Against Louisville, led the V4+ to second place finishing the course in 7 minutes and 36.3 seconds
- Coxed the V4+ against Minnesota with a time of 7 minutes and 36.4 seconds on the 2000-meter course
- With a time of 17 minutes and 24.5 seconds placed 8th at the Head of the Hooch in Chattanooga in the Open 8
- Guided UT's V8+ to a 30th-place finish at the prestigious Head of the Charles with a time of 18 minutes and 11.03 seconds
- Coxed the Collegiate 4+ to a first place finish with a time of 18 minutes and 46.75 seconds at the Chattanooga Head Race
- Led the Collegiate 8+ to a 3rd place finish at the Chattanooga Head Race with a time of 16 minutes and 54.51 seconds
2011-12 - Freshman
- Led UT's 2V8+ to gold at the 2012 C-USA Championship, crossing the finish line in 6 minutes 52.40 seconds
- Coxed the 2V8+ to a strong regular-season finish at No. 7 Princeton
- Guided the 2V8+ at Michigan
- Coxed the 2V4+ to a win over Central Florida
- Guided the 2V8+ at the Oak Ridge Invitational, winning a gold and to silver medals
- Coxed Club 8+ shell to gold medal at Head of the Charles Regatta
- Guided Collegiate 4+ to seventh and C8+ to eighth at Chattanooga Head Race
- Coxed Championship 8+ to eighth at Head of the Hooch
